What Is an EPC for Businesses?

An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) for commercial properties assesses the building’s energy efficiency on a scale from A (most efficient) to G (least efficient). It evaluates factors such as heating, ventilation, air conditioning (HVAC), lighting, insulation, and renewable energy integration.


Importance of EPCs in Business Energy Reporting

1. Regulatory Compliance

Many jurisdictions mandate EPCs for commercial buildings when leasing, selling, or constructing properties. Compliance helps businesses avoid fines and legal penalties.

2. Identifying Energy Efficiency Opportunities

EPC assessments provide detailed reports that highlight inefficiencies and recommend improvements, helping businesses reduce operational costs.

3. Supporting Sustainability Goals

Transparent energy reporting via EPCs allows companies to track progress toward environmental targets and improve corporate social responsibility (CSR) profiles.

4. Enhancing Property Value and Marketability

Energy-efficient commercial properties with strong EPC ratings attract tenants and buyers seeking lower operating expenses and greener workplaces.


EPC and Energy Performance Reporting Integration

EPC data often feeds into broader energy management and reporting frameworks such as:

  • ISO 50001 Energy Management Systems

  • Corporate Sustainability Reporting (e.g., GRI, CDP)

  • Building Energy Benchmarking Programs

This integration enables businesses to benchmark energy use, identify trends, and strategize improvements.
